This instrument meets the requirements for the determination of non methane total hydrocarbons from organized and unorganized emissions of fixed pollution sources, as well as the determination of total hydrocarbons in ambient air, and is superior to the national environmental protection standards (HJ604-2011) "Determination of total hydrocarbons in ambient air by gas chromatography" and HJ/T38-1999 "Determination of non methane total hydrocarbons in exhaust gas from fixed pollution sources by gas chromatography".
Characteristic introduction:
The unique dual quantitative tube gas injection valve, dual hydrogen flame ionization detector, dual microcurrent amplifier, and dual channel data output can achieve the analysis of total hydrocarbons/non methane total hydrocarbons in pollution source exhaust gas in one injection, with simple operation, good reproducibility, and high accuracy. Configure dedicated chromatographic workstations for the determination of non methane total hydrocarbons and ambient air total hydrocarbons, and enable networked remote data transmission for easy remote monitoring.

The unique gas path stabilization process design greatly reduces the interference of pressure fluctuations on the entire gas path process and detector during gas injection. The unique vaporization chamber and hydrogen flame nozzle structure design greatly improve the sensitivity and reproducibility of gas analysis, making it more suitable for gas analysis. It can flexibly implement various injection methods such as gas injectors, gas injection valves, gas headspace samplers, thermal analysis, and can be equipped with methane conversion furnaces, column switching valves, and other devices.
Introduction to the characteristics of the dedicated chromatographic workstation for the determination of non methane total hydrocarbons and ambient air total hydrocarbons: Non methane total hydrocarbon determination: can graft the spectra of two channels in real time onto one spectrum for calculation, automatically deduct methane concentration from the total hydrocarbon concentration, and also deduct manually entered oxygen concentration. Measurement of total hydrocarbons in ambient air: The concentration of total hydrocarbons and oxygen in two spectra can be calculated separately using the working curve (or correction factor) of methane, and the concentration of oxygen can be subtracted from the concentration of total hydrocarbons.
